// Notes for the weekly eng sync re: Gallerywhisper, our museum audio-guide app.
// This constant sets the prefetch radius for exhibit audio clips. At the
// Hollen Pavilion pilot we learned visitors walk faster than our original
// estimate, so clips were buffering mid-stride. Bumping this to three rooms
// ahead fixed it, at a modest bandwidth cost. Don't lower it without testing
// on the slow gallery wifi first — seriously, it's painful. The trace token
// from the pilot build that validated this number is appended just below.

trace token, kahap-bagaf: htk4_8458

**Handover: Export retry queue (from Dara to Olun's team)**

Failed exports from the Lanternfold reporting service land in a retry queue that is *not* automatic — someone must trigger replays manually each morning. Always check the failure reason first; auth errors will just fail again until the partner token is refreshed. The replay procedure, with screenshots and known edge cases, is documented on the page below.

wiki page, tahaf-tajog: https://jira.ordindyn.corp/pipeline

// SQL_LINT_RULESET
//
// This constant pins the lint ruleset applied to all .sql files in the
// Tarnwick repo. New team members: don't bump the version casually —
// rules like mandatory table aliases and uppercase keywords are enforced
// in CI, and a mismatch between local and CI rulesets causes confusing
// failures. The ruleset is versioned alongside the linter binary, and
// the pinned build is identified by the token below.

pipeline stamp: htk31_f769b577b3028a4e9958e5bb8d1259a